William Marshall
Summary
William Marshall is a human[1]. He was born in Chicago[2]. He was born on October 12, 1917[3]. He passed away in Boulogne-Billancourt[4]. He died on June 7, 1994[5]. He worked as an actor[6], bandleader[7], film actor[8], singer[9], and film director[10]. Personal Life
Spouses include Ginger Rogers[13], a film actor[28], 1911–1995[29], of United States[30], awarded the Academy Award for Best Actress[31]; Michèle Morgan[14], a film actor[32], 1920–2016[33], of France[34], awarded the Officer of the National Order of Merit[35]; and Micheline Presle[15], a film actor[36], 1922–2024[37], of France[38], awarded the Commandeur des Arts et des Lettres[39]. Children include Mike Marshall[16], a film actor[40], 1944–2005[41], of France[42] and Tonie Marshall[17], a film director[43], 1951–2020[44], of France[45], awarded the César Award for Best Director[46].
Death and Burial
William Marshall died on June 7, 1994[5]. He died in Boulogne-Billancourt[4]. He is buried at Richarville[12].
